      Develops medical equipment plans, including budgets and specifications, for new KP medical facilities, major renovations and expansion of existing medical facilities. Evaluates, locates and recommends equipment to be purchased. Consults with medical and administrative personnel, architects, and contractors on the same. Identifies equipment and design conflicts during the design process to avoid costly construction delays. Develops and updates budgets for project start-ups. Conducts value cost analysis and comparative equipment studies to recommend the most cost and time effective systems. Provides accurate and sufficient information for project teams during the design, implementation and installation process. Provides knowledgeable responses to client's questions when medical equipment issues arise.
